Solution for Permanent Hair Removal
Should you be concerned about the safety of laser hair removal treatments? We don’t think so! The laser hair removal procedure has been approved by the FDA with the recommendation that the actual hair removal procedure only be performed by a licensed and trained technician or doctor. During this procedure, a almost invisible laser beam used to destroy the hair follicles. This procedure is relatively painless and works best on individuals who have light colored skin and contrasting dark hair. The estimated cost of these laser sessions can cost from a few hundred dollars to a few thousand dollars, depending on the size of the area treated.
Cost of Laser Hair Removal Treatments
Laser hair removal costs can range widely from state to state and country to country. Honestly, the laser hair removal costs will vary dependent on each person’s type and makeup of hair. Since each woman has a unique pattern for hair growth, the results and the price of laser treatments will also be unique.
You will also find that laser hair removal prices can also vary even between clinics in the same area. The following details the typical pricing structures used by laser hair removal clinics to determine the cost of their procedures:
Flat or Fixed Fee - There are a few different alternatives with this pricing method - a per treatment or per package basis. What this means is that a woman’s legs could be quoted at $350 per treatment, regardless of the amount of hair to be removed. An alternative is where a clinic will charge a flat fee for a package of treatments.
Fee Per Pulse - To get a clearer picture of this price structure, you need to understand how the laser equipment functions. Each time the laser equipment emits the laser light, it is called a “pulse”. You will find that there are clinics that price based on the number of pulses that it takes to complete the procedure. The fact is that one pulse only takes about a second and will actually remove close to one hundred hairs. If this pricing structure is used, there can also a minimum charge for the treated area. This will result in the cost being the greater of the number of pulses time the price/pulse, or a minimum fee for the specific body area being treated.
Treatment Time - The last pricing practice is very similar to that used for the electrolysis process. Laser hair removal clinics using this method usually charge per 15 minute segments of laser treatment.
